Transaction 161dc004eae4cb137df349df20b2e9fa810c07cf59a873cfdcbfdde3a122320b

1 Input
2 Outputs
  • 161dc004eae4cb137df349df20b2e9fa810c07cf59a873cfdcbfdde3a122320b:0
  • value  1169313784
    address  1Hcz2LmGkugtu7TNXQUSaUgquS7jzTVKpE
  • 161dc004eae4cb137df349df20b2e9fa810c07cf59a873cfdcbfdde3a122320b:1
  • value  18137403
    address  14WuWwpTSGmi7JcX2Kpy6jvC81YFuKiVVF